Renowned Pianist Ruth Slenczynska Dies at 93

Ruth Slenczynska, a celebrated American pianist, passed away peacefully at her home in California at the age of 93. Born in California to Polish parents, Slenczynska established herself as a significant figure in classical music throughout her career. Her musical journey began at a young age; she gave her first recital at four and performed with the entire orchestra in Paris at seven.

Throughout her life, she was recognized for her exceptional technique and profound musicality. Slenczynska had the unique opportunity to perform for five American presidents, a testament to her talent and standing within the musical community. A particularly memorable experience occurred during a duet with Harry Truman in the White House, a truly special moment in her career.

Despite her advanced age, Slenczynska continued to perform into her 90s, culminating in the release of her final album in 2022. Former student Shelly Moorman-Stahlman described her passing, stating, “Tonight, the heavens have received a very special angel.”
